Another Flagship to our Mysore city – to get an offer to install the Electric Vehicle Charging stations in Highway Lanes

Electric Vehicle Charging Station

Mysuru : Chamundeshwari Electricity Supply Corporation Limited (CESC), based in Mysuru, which manages the distribution of electricity in five districts of Mysuru, Chamarajanagar, Mandya, Hassan and Kodagu, has submitted a proposal to the state government to identify 150 charging point station in five neighborhoods.

Among them, 10 charging stations will be installed on the Bengaluru –Mysuru 10-lane economic corridor from Maddur to Mysuru, where the CESC has its jurisdiction.

Chamundeshwari Electricity Supply Corporation Limited successfully launched its first electric vehicle charging station in the Mysuru region, Current, at its office in Vijayanagar. Now, a application has been sent to the government to mount 150 charging stations in 5 districts: Kodagu.Mysuru, Chamarajanagar, Mandya and Hassan

10 electric vehicle charging stations will be installed by Maddur in Mysuru on the Mysuru-Bengaluru 10-lane economic corridor and a request has already been sent to the National Highways Authority of India (NHAI) which is building the corridor. “The Chamundeshwari Electricity Supply Corporation Limited has asked the NHAI to identify places including toll plazas, rest areas and restaurants along the Corridor where vehicles stop and at the same time can take a break until the vehicle is fully loaded, ”explained by Managing Director of CESC.

NHAI is already planning to install several electric vehicles charging stations that will help modernize the electric vehicle infrastructure in India. The plan is part of the real estate development along the national roads. According to sources, NHAI has recognized more than 650 assets in 22 states with a joint area of over 3,000 acres for road infrastructure development.

Installing electric vehicle charging stations along national highways will be of great help to electric vehicle owners in India, who are often concerned about the limits of using battery-powered cars for long-distance travel. There are currently too few electric vehicle charging stations along highways to meet the needs of proprietary electric vehicles. The installation of electric vehicle charging stations along national highways is also likely to foster the culture of electric vehicles in the country.

As part of the Phase II program to accelerate the adoption and production of (hybrid and) electric vehicles in India (FAME India), 184 electric vehicle charging stations have been offered on 9 highways, including the Mysore Bengaluru corridor. .

The charging stations for electric vehicles that Chamundeshwari Electricity Supply Corporation Limited has proposed would be implemented according to the Public Private Partnership (PPP) model and Chamundeshwari Electricity Supply Corporation Limited will incur no costs. “The NHAI will allocate the land and the individual requesting the tender or supply contact will load the vehicles and keep the load units. Only the energy will be supplied by the CESC and the energy prices will be invoiced at the unit rates in force.
